Transaction 6ac695a322f42abe9d4419860e506f1dcd0e2288b6834c9d8f380f7342411b96
1 Input
1 Output
-
6ac695a322f42abe9d4419860e506f1dcd0e2288b6834c9d8f380f7342411b96:0
- value
- 627266
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85a5d836b179af28956ba135365769f64b0f564b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DBfYbdxg21qzSwhwJBqJd4BGnx6U1f2QK